How to win a stamp bid on eBay (This is my suggestion...follow your own policy for best results)

Use this site to reach your favorite categories and place a bid on whatever you feel is a real bargain for the price mentioned. Or whatever it is you really want.

If you don't get outbid, good, but if you do, don't go back and bid on the auction again right away. This will only get you into a bidding war and increase the ending price, even if you are the winner.

Note the time the auction ends and bid on it exactly 30 seconds from end of the auction (15 - 45 seconds depending on your connection speed).

Decide the maximum price you are willing to pay for the auction. When you are bidding at the last minute, use this figure as the maximum bid price, even if it substantially higher than the current price. You most probably won't have to pay this price but it stops any other person from making a second bid for the auction.

This is the best and nearly foolproof way to ensure you win the auction. But this is not rocket-science. So be prepared to have some company at the closing time - lots of bidders do it. And this probably cannot compete with the automated eBay bidders that some sites offer.
